Browsing haccp food safety, United Kingdom business
16 Kimberworth Park Road | rotherham
Minster | Ramsgate, CT12 4HY
Unit 3 Heart of Wales Business Park | Llandrindod Wells, LD15AB
We use cookies to improve the user experience
learn more. If you continue browsing you accept their use.
Understood